ホームページ  >  記事  >  データベース  >  mysqlでパスワードをリセットする方法

mysqlでパスワードをリセットする方法

PHPz
PHPzオリジナル
2024-02-18 12:41:12780ブラウズ

mysqlでパスワードをリセットする方法

MySQL は、さまざまなタイプのアプリケーション開発で広く使用されているオープンソースのリレーショナル データベース管理システムです。 MySQL データベースを使用する場合、データベースのセキュリティを向上させるためにパスワードの変更が必要になることがよくあります。この記事では、MySQL パスワードを変更する方法を具体的なコード例を通して紹介します。

MySQL では、次の手順でパスワードを変更できます。

  1. MySQL データベース サーバーにログインします。
    コマンド プロンプトまたはターミナル ウィンドウを開き、次のコマンドを実行します:

    mysql -u root -p

    管理者ユーザー名 (通常は root) を入力し、Enter キーを押すと、パスワードの入力を求められます。パスワードを入力して Enter キーを押し、MySQL データベース サーバーにログインします。

  2. パスワードを変更する必要があるユーザーに切り替えます:
    ログインに成功したら、次のコマンドを使用してパスワードを変更する必要があるユーザーに切り替えます:

    USE mysql;

    上記のコマンドの mysql は、MySQL データベースのシステム ライブラリです。

  3. 現在のユーザーのパスワード ポリシーを表示します:
    次のコマンドを実行して、現在のユーザーのパスワード ポリシーを表示します:

    SELECT host, user, plugin FROM user WHERE user = '需要修改密码的用户名';

    「パスワードを変更する必要があるユーザー」を変更します。上記のコマンド「name」の「password」を、実際に変更する必要があるユーザー名に置き換えます。実行が成功すると、現在のユーザーのホスト、ユーザー名、およびパスワードのプラグイン タイプが返されます。

  4. ユーザー パスワードを変更します:
    次のコマンドを実行してユーザー パスワードを変更します:

    ALTER USER '需要修改密码的用户名'@'localhost' IDENTIFIED BY '新密码';

    「パスワードを変更する必要があるユーザー名」を置き換えます。実際に必要な上記のコマンドは、パスワードのユーザー名を変更し、「localhost」を実際のホスト名またはIPアドレスに置き換え、「新しいパスワード」を実際に設定されている新しいパスワードに置き換えます。実行が成功すると、パスワードが正常に変更されたことを示すプロンプトが返されます。

  5. アクセス許可を更新します:
    次のコマンドを実行してアクセス許可を更新し、変更したパスワードを有効にします:

    FLUSH PRIVILEGES;

    実行が成功すると、アクセス許可を正常に更新するためのプロンプトが表示されます。返されます。

上記の手順により、MySQL ユーザーのパスワードを正常に変更できます。

特定の構文とコマンドは MySQL のバージョンによって異なる場合があることに注意してください。上記のコード例を実行する際は、実際の状況に応じて適切に調整してください。

概要:
この記事では、具体的なコード例を通じて、MySQL データベースのパスワードを変更する方法を紹介します。パスワードを変更するには、まず MySQL データベース サーバーにログインし、次にパスワードを変更する必要があるユーザーに切り替え、現在のユーザーのパスワード ポリシーを表示して、ユーザーのパスワードを変更し、最後に権限を更新します。上記の手順により、MySQL ユーザーのパスワードを正常に変更し、データベースのセキュリティを向上させることができます。

以上がmysqlでパスワードをリセットする方法の詳細内容です。詳細については、PHP 中国語 Web サイトの他の関連記事を参照してください。

声明:
この記事の内容はネチズンが自主的に寄稿したものであり、著作権は原著者に帰属します。このサイトは、それに相当する法的責任を負いません。盗作または侵害の疑いのあるコンテンツを見つけた場合は、admin@php.cn までご連絡ください。